Officials said the building that collapsed was CJ’z Downtown Billiards, which was scheduled to open at 5 p.m. Three other buildings were damaged in the front as a result of the collapse.
Officials said the building collapsed around 2:27 p.m.
Search and rescue crews are currently trying to navigate through the site of the collapse, including crews from Pulaski County. Officials said they are currently trying to get the power shut off.
CJ’z Downtown Billiards shared a post after the incident.
“Everyone is ok & thats whats important. We haven't made it there yet, but on the way (thanks PG!),” the business wrote on Facebook. “Please let us get things handled. Our phones are blowing up & we have stuff to take care of. We appreciate you all checking in so this post is to tell you we are ok. Will update soon… love yall!!!”
Three of the four total affected buildings had tenants, but officials have not released whether anyone was in the buildings.
